| /* ftdi_out.c |
| * |
| * Output a (stream of) byte(s) in bitbang mode to the |
| * ftdi245 chip that is (hopefully) attached. |
| * |
| * We have a little board that has a FT245BM chip and |
| * the 8 outputs are connected to several different |
| * things that we can turn on and off with this program. |
| * |
| * If you have an idea about hardware that can easily |
| * interface onto an FTDI chip, I'd like to collect |
| * ideas. If I find it worthwhile to make, I'll consider |
| * making it, I'll even send you a prototype (against |
| * cost-of-material) if you want. |
| * |
| * At "harddisk-recovery.nl" they have a little board that |
| * controls the power to two harddrives and two fans. |
| * |
| * -- REW R.E.Wolff@BitWizard.nl |
| * |
| * |
| * |
| * This program was based on libftdi_example_bitbang2232.c |
| * which doesn't carry an author or attribution header. |
| * |
| * |
| * This program is distributed under the GPL, version 2. |
| * Millions copies of the GPL float around the internet. |
| */ |
| |
| |
| #include <stdio.h> |
| #include <stdlib.h> |
| #include <unistd.h> |
| #ifdef __WIN32__ |
| #define usleep(x) Sleep((x+999)/1000) |
| #endif |
| #include <ftdi.h> |
| |
| void ftdi_fatal (struct ftdi_context *ftdi, char *str) |
| { |
| fprintf (stderr, "%s: %s\n", |
| str, ftdi_get_error_string (ftdi)); |
| ftdi_free(ftdi); |
| exit (1); |
| } |
| |
| int main(int argc, char **argv) |
| { |
| struct ftdi_context *ftdi; |
| int i, t; |
| unsigned char data; |
| int delay = 100000; /* 100 thousand microseconds: 1 tenth of a second */ |
| |
| while ((t = getopt (argc, argv, "d:")) != -1) |
| { |
| switch (t) |
| { |
| case 'd': |
| delay = atoi (optarg); |
| break; |
| } |
| } |
| |
| if ((ftdi = ftdi_new()) == 0) |
| { |
| fprintf(stderr, "ftdi_bew failed\n"); |
| return EXIT_FAILURE; |
| } |
| |
| if (ftdi_usb_open(ftdi, 0x0403, 0x6001) < 0) |
| ftdi_fatal (ftdi, "Can't open ftdi device"); |
| |
| if (ftdi_set_bitmode(ftdi, 0xFF, BITMODE_BITBANG) < 0) |
| ftdi_fatal (ftdi, "Can't enable bitbang"); |
| |
| for (i=optind; i < argc ; i++) |
| { |
| sscanf (argv[i], "%x", &t); |
| data = t; |
| if (ftdi_write_data(ftdi, &data, 1) < 0) |
| { |
| fprintf(stderr,"write failed for 0x%x: %s\n", |
| data, ftdi_get_error_string(ftdi)); |
| } |
| usleep(delay); |
| } |
| |
| ftdi_usb_close(ftdi); |
| ftdi_free(ftdi); |
| exit (0); |
| } |
